As mention in this thread on changing MrsWombat's EMP to a single sided safety she has had some issues with HollowPoints on her 9mm EMP. As the this is no longer about the safety I've started a new thread.

 

Out of the 133 Hollow Points she tried to shoot at the weekend she had over 110 Failure to Feeds and/or Light Primer Strikes. This was after 724 rounds of FMJ over the last 8 or so months without issue.

 

We tried a variety of Hollow Points including:

  • Speer Gold Dot 9mm: 124gr +P Hollow Point Short Barrel (23611)
  • Federal LE Tactical 9mm Luger: 124gr +P HST (P9HST3)
  • Federal LE Tactical 9mm Luger: 124gr +P EFMJ (P9CSP1)
  • Winchester Ranger Talon 9mm Luger: 124gr +P HP (RA9124TP)
  • Black Hills 9mm: 115gr +P Tac-XP (D9N10)
  • Corbon 9mm Luger: 125gr +P JHP (SD09125)
  • Hornady Critical Duty 9mm Luger: 135gr +P FlexLock (90226)

I sent an email to Springfield Armory Warranty on Monday 3rd September evening (Labor Day), by 10:11am on the Tuesday I had a response from Springfield Armory seeking to clarify a couple of points and our contact details and by 10:27 I had received a FEDEX shipping label to return the EMP to Springfield Armory to investigate and resolve the issue.

 

I have to say I am very impressed. Compare to my Sig issue I have to give Springfield Armory an A+ for customer service response (so far) compared to the D- for Sig.

We received the EMP back yesterday - so two weeks including the shipping. The enclosed invoice (for $0) states:

  • Recut Barrel Ramp
  • Polished Feed Ramp
  • 1911-A1 Barrel Link
  • Tuned Extractor
  • Test Fired - No Malfunctions

 

We'll take the EMP to the range sometime soon and see how well it does with the Hollow Points.
